    Spring in Gdansk (March – May)

    Spring in Gdansk is a time of renewal and awakening. As the city sheds its winter cloak, a vibrant tapestry of colors unfolds, with blossoming trees and blooming flowers adorning the streets. Temperatures begin to rise, making it pleasant for leisurely strolls along the waterfront or exploring the city’s historic landmarks.

    Pleasant Weather

    March to May brings milder temperatures, averaging between 5°C and 15°C (41°F to 59°F). The days grow longer, offering ample sunshine and opportunities to enjoy outdoor activities.

    Blooming Gardens and Parks

    Spring is the perfect time to witness the city’s beautiful gardens and parks in full bloom. The Planty Park, a green oasis encircling the Old Town, transforms into a vibrant spectacle of colors. The Oliwa Park, with its sprawling lawns and majestic trees, offers a serene escape from the city’s hustle and bustle.

    Easter Celebrations

    Easter in Gdansk is a special occasion, marked by traditional processions, religious services, and festive markets. The city comes alive with a festive atmosphere, offering a unique cultural experience.

    Summer in Gdansk (June – August)

    Summer in Gdansk is a time of sunshine, warmth, and vibrant energy. The city’s beaches come alive with beachgoers, while the streets are filled with tourists and locals alike, enjoying the long summer days.

    Warm and Sunny Days

    June to August boasts the warmest temperatures, averaging between 18°C and 25°C (64°F to 77°F). The sun shines brightly, creating perfect conditions for outdoor activities, including swimming, sunbathing, and exploring the city’s attractions.     Beach Life and Water Activities

    Gdansk’s beaches, such as Jelitkowo and Stogi, offer a haven for sunseekers and water enthusiasts. Swimming, sunbathing, volleyball, and windsurfing are popular activities. Boat trips and cruises along the Motława River are also a great way to experience the city from a different perspective.

    Summer Festivals and Events

    Gdansk comes alive with a plethora of summer festivals and events, celebrating music, art, culture, and cuisine. The Gdansk Shakespeare Festival, the Sopot International Film Festival, and the Polish Amber Festival are just a few of the highlights.

    Autumn in Gdansk (September – November)

    Autumn in Gdansk is a season of transition, marked by vibrant foliage and a cozy atmosphere. The air turns crisp, and the days become shorter, creating a sense of tranquility.

    Crisp Air and Colorful Foliage

    September to November brings cooler temperatures, averaging between 10°C and 18°C (50°F to 64°F). The trees transform into a breathtaking display of reds, oranges, and yellows, creating a picturesque backdrop for walks and explorations.

    Cultural Events and Museums

    Autumn is a great time to delve into Gdansk’s rich cultural scene. The city’s numerous museums, art galleries, and theaters offer a wide range of exhibitions and performances.

    Maritime Heritage and History

    Gdansk’s maritime heritage is deeply ingrained in its history. Visiting the Gdansk Shipyard, the Polish Baltic Frederic Chopin Philharmonic, and the National Maritime Museum provides insights into the city’s fascinating past.

    Winter in Gdansk (December – February)

    Festive Markets and Christmas Spirit

    December is a time for celebration, with traditional Christmas markets popping up throughout the city. The aroma of mulled wine and gingerbread fills the air, while twinkling lights adorn the streets, creating a festive ambiance.

    Ice Skating and Winter Activities

    Ice skating rinks transform into popular gathering spots, offering a fun activity for all ages. Winter walks along the waterfront, bundled up in warm clothing, provide a unique perspective of the city’s beauty.

    Cultural Events and Performances

    Despite the cold, Gdansk’s cultural scene remains vibrant during winter. Theaters, concert halls, and museums offer a range of performances and exhibitions to keep visitors entertained.

    Best Time to Visit Gdansk Poland – FAQs

    What is the best time to visit Gdansk for good weather?

    The best time to visit Gdansk for pleasant weather is during the summer months (June to August), when temperatures are warm and sunny.

    Is Gdansk crowded during peak season?

    Yes, Gdansk can be quite crowded during peak season, which typically runs from June to August.

    What are some popular festivals in Gdansk?

    Some popular festivals in Gdansk include the Gdansk Shakespeare Festival, the Sopot International Film Festival, and the Polish Amber Festival.

    What is the weather like in Gdansk in winter?

    Are there any special events or activities during Christmas in Gdansk?

    Yes, Gdansk hosts traditional Christmas markets during the holiday season, with festive decorations, food stalls, and entertainment.
